Opinion: This is why Khupe targeted these 4 MDC A MPs. The four MPs are Chalton Hwende, Lilian Timveos, Thabitha Khumalo and Prosper Mutseyami. Constitutional law expert and political analyst, Alex Magaisa has given his perspective on the decision by Thokozani Khupe to recall just four MDC Alliance MPs from Parliament.

Writing in his latest Big Saturday Read titled “BSR: Concerning the recall of MDC Alliance MPs”, Magaisa suggested three reasons why Khupe and her Secretary General Douglas Mwonzora expelled the four. He said:

First, these four MPs have been chosen because they are the leaders of the MDC-Alliance in Parliament. Khumalo, who is the MDC Alliance Chairperson is the leader of the opposition in the National Assembly while Timveos is the leader of the opposition in the Senate. Mutseyami is the MDC Alliance Chief Whip while Charlton Hwende is the Secretary-General of the party.

The idea appears to be to attack the head of the MDC Alliance. Mwonzora and Hwende have had a long-standing battle which culminated in the battle for the Secretary-Generalship at the MDC Alliance Congress in 2019 in which Hwende prevailed. This part of the recall seems like a continuation of a personal war marked by a streak of vindictiveness.

The second part of the strategy is to divide and rule. Mwonzora’s notice could have applied to all MPs they claim to be their party’s members in Parliament.

They have chosen a small group in the hope of isolating them from the larger group. This, they hope, serves as a notice to the remainder of MPs whose position is now precarious.

The newfound power of recall now hangs like the sword of Damocles above the heads of the remaining MPs. The hope is that the other MPs will be cowed into submission and follow the demands of the group that wants to reconstitute the MDC-T following the Supreme Court judgment.

The recall is a strategy to coerce MDC Alliance MPs into supporting the group that was dubiously awarded a judgment by the Supreme Court. They know that an MP’s seat represents an important part of an MP’s personal political economy. It brings prestige, power and material benefits to the individual MP.

This situation, therefore, represents a stern moral test for each MDC Alliance MP. They must make a choice between safeguarding their personal political economy, which would be selfish or acting for the greater good of the party under which they were elected, the MDC Alliance, which would be selfless.

To go with the view that they are MDC-T members would be to forsake the MDC Alliance, the party under which they campaigned and were elected into Parliament. It would also be politically duplicitous; fraud on the people who voted them as MDC Alliance representatives.

The third, which is also a strategy of divide and rule relates to the MDC Alliance as a whole. If Khupe, Mwonzora and Komichi can successfully isolate so-called MDC-T MPs, from the MDC Alliance and the other MDC Alliance MPs carry on, they will leave Chamisa politically vulnerable.

The real target of this grand political strategy is the person who provides the most credible political competition to Emmerson Mnangagwa.

If the MDC Alliance succumbs to this divide and rule, it will be the end of opposition politics as we have known it for the past two decades. And this will have been achieved by paying one faction of the MDC against the other.

Trevor Noah has slammed those who refuse to wear face masks in public to prevent the spread of Covid-19, saying the instruction to wear masks is there to protect us. Speaking on The Daily Show on Tuesday, Trevor cast the spotlight on several incidents of people not wearing masks that made the news, including a park being shut down because thousands of people were not wearing masks and a security guard being shot during a dispute over a face mask.

He also shared a report of a man who wiped his nose on a worker’s shirt after he was asked why he wasn’t wearing a face covering. Trevor was shocked by the reports and said that scientists need to forget a vaccine and start working on a chill pill. Health officials are asking for US to cover OUR faces to protect OURSELVES and everyone is acting like they have to be spayed and neutered. The people who don’t wear masks are ruining it for everyone.

Trevor Noah

Trevor asked why so many people refused to wear masks when it is for their own protection. He said he understood that it was uncomfortable and made it harder to breathe but the alternative was far worse. Do you know what makes it harder to breathe? Coronavirus! The SA government has been encouraging the use of face masks in public for more than a month and last week National Treasury and the department of trade & industry published guidelines for their use.

Regulations also require any user of public transport to wear a mask. The health ministry has said that while face masks may not prevent the wearer from catching the virus, it can stop those who have it from inadvertently spreading it.

“Since some persons with the coronavirus may not have symptoms or may not know they are infected, everyone should wear a face mask,” a statement by Dr A Pillay, acting director-general, on the government’s official Covid-19 resource and news portal read. Health minister Dr Zweli Mkhize told a news briefing last month that he aimed to have the wearing of masks become a part of South African culture in time.

Report: European Union to Blacklist Zimbabwe over terrorist funding. The European Commission is set to include Panama, the Bahamas, Mauritius and nine other countries to its list of States that pose a financial risk to the bloc because of anti-money laundering and terrorism financing shortfalls, a draft document shows.

The document, seen by Reuters and expected to be published tomorrow, also includes Barbados, Botswana, Cambodia, Ghana, Jamaica, Mongolia, Myanmar, Nicaragua and Zimbabwe to the European Union listing.

Countries on the list “pose significant threats to the financial system of the EU,” the draft document, which is still subject to changes, says.

Under EU law, banks and other financial and tax firms are obliged to scrutinise more closely their clients who have dealings with countries on the list.

Chiwenga wanted to bring English clubs to the country before Stadium ban. United Kingdom-based FIFA licensed match agent Ellen Chiwenga claims she was working on bringing English Premier League teams to Zimbabwe when the Confederation of African Football (CAF) banned the country’s stadiums from hosting international games.

Posting on her Facebook account, Chiwenga said everything was almost done and they were working on the dates. She said:

I was hurt when Zimbabwe was banned from hosting international matches at local venues. I was working on bringing the EPL to Zimbabwe and facilitating a shirt sponsorship deal like that of Arsenal and Rwanda. We were only left on finalising the dates.

CAF banned all of Zimbabwe’s stadiums early this year, saying they did not meet the minimum standards for hosting international football matches and needed massive renovations.

The ban was put in place ahead of the postponed Afcon qualifiers at the end of March. A second inspection was conducted in April for the World Cup qualifiers but the suspension was upheld.

Hurungwe man trampled to death by elephants. Kenneth Machengo from Laughing Hills Farm in ward 18, was attacked by one of the seven elephants while harvesting his maize crop.

A 68-year-old Hurungwe man was trampled to death when a herd of elephants invaded his field on Monday last week. His body was discovered by villagers with signs of severe injuries sustained during the attack.

Zimbabwe Parks and Wildlife Management Authority (Zimparks) spokesperson, Tinashe Farawo, confirmed the incident. It is sad that one elderly man from Hurungwe lost his life after he was attacked by elephants on Monday (last week), he said. We are, however, doing all we can to drive away the animals as they now have ability further cause damage to crops and loss of human lives.

Due to overpopulation of the elephants, human-animal conflicts are now a major challenge in low lying communities that share boundaries with game reserves. World bodies have continued to restrict Zimbabwe from killing elephants and selling ivory, resulting in overpopulation.

The Communal Areas Management Programme for Indigenous Resources programme, which was initiated to financially support people affected by wild animal challenges, is being revived.

Recently, villagers in Mhangura Constituency pleaded with Zimparks to resolve the issue of stray elephants and a pride of lions that were threatening crops, livestock and humans.

S.e.x workers back in the streets, risk contracting COVID-19. The pandemic has hit the world’s oldest profession hard following the lockdown restrictions that saw their hunting grounds being shut to avert the spread of the deadly disease.

Commercial s.e.x workers are living in fear of contracting the coronavirus from their clients and are currently inquiring on best ways to practise safe s.e.x to avoid infection.

Life Health Education Development director Primrose Fundai, whose organisation works with commercial s.e.x workers, said they had begun researching on safe s.e.x during the pandemic as most of them rely on s.e.x work for a living.

“We advise them to respect social distancing, but given the lockdown extension, they cannot bear it,” she said. Fundai said some of the s.e.x workers were failing to access medication.

“The s.e.x workers are affected as denoted by massive food shortages. Since the lockdown, they have been struggling to survive as before. Some need to go and collect their medication during this lockdown but they do not have written letters to permit them to travel. They are being hindered by the restrictions,” she added. Fundai said it was high time government honoured its pledge to provide a relief fund, adding that a number of s.e.x workers registered for the money.

There are close to 400 s.e.x workers in Marondera with the number increasing during the tobacco selling season. The opening of a tobacco sales floor in the town’s industrial area is expected to attract s.e.x workers from as far as Mutare once lockdown restrictions are eased.

Guard loses gun to robbers during an attack. Leeroy Ncube (24) of Mahatshula suburb and the three accomplices who are still at large allegedly went to Camstick Mine at Famona Business Centre in Inyathi armed with knives and stones.

An illegal gold panner allegedly teamed up with three accomplices and raided a gold mine in Inyathi where they attacked a security guard before disarming him of his service pistol, which they later used to rob local shops.  Upon arrival, they allegedly struck Mr Nqobizitha Dube who was manning the premises with stones and he fell to the ground. They rushed to the scene and allegedly grabbed him by the neck as he lay on the ground.

The four robbers stabbed him on the leg with a knife before disarming him of a Taurus revolver which was loaded with five rounds of ammunition. This emerged when Ncube, who is facing robbery charges approached the High Court seeking bail.

Ncube through his lawyers Mathonsi Ncube Law Chambers filed an application for bail pending trial at the Bulawayo High Court citing the State as a respondent. In his bail statement, Ncube is denying the charges, arguing that there was no evidence linking him to the offence.

“I was with my friends watching movies on the day in question and I believe the complainant’s identification must be tested in light of his alibi,” he said. Ncube argued that there were no compelling reasons by the investigating officer for him to be denied bail.

“The investigating officer, in this case, has deposed of an affidavit opposing my bail application. He argued that I was of no fixed abode, was likely to interfere with investigations and that since the stolen firearm has not been recovered, I am likely to regroup with my accomplices who are still at large and commit more robberies if released on bail,” he said.

Ncube challenged the investigating officer’s assertions, saying his grounds for challenging his bail were speculative and baseless. “It is submitted that the fact that no firearm was recovered from me points to my innocence rather than guilt. The commission of other offences is also purely speculative and not founded on any real fact,” he said.

Ncube said there was no basis by the investigating officer that if released on bail he would abscond. He offered to pay $500 bail and to report once a fortnight at Queen Park Police Station as part of the bail conditions. Ncube also offered to continue residing at his given address until the matter is finalised.

The State is yet to respond. According to court papers, it was stated that on April 5 this year, Dube was on duty at Camstick Mine in Inyathi when Ncube in the company of three accomplices spotted him from their spot under the cover of darkness.

They allegedly struck Dube with a stone on the right side of the ribs and he fell down before they rushed to the scene. Ncube grabbed the security guard by the neck and sat on his chest before one of them pulled a knife and struck him on the left leg. Dube managed to positively identify Ncube’s face.

They used the same knife to cut off the buckle of a holster containing his pistol, which was loaded with five rounds of ammunition. They took the firearm and disappeared into the dark. They allegedly used the pistol to rob shops around the area.

On April 21, detectives who were on patrol received a tip-off from Dube after he had spotted Ncube at Famona Business Centre in Inyathi leading to his arrest.
